Fit & Sizing (Tall Girl Notes):
I ordered a medium, and while it technically fits, I probably should have gone with a small.
This cover-up wants to be more form-skimming than it is on me. Because I sized up (ordered my normal size…which is a little big for this top), it reads a little more drapey and relaxed than fitted. It’s not unflattering, just looser than intended or that I prefer.
For reference, I’m 5’10”, around 155 lbs, with a long torso and long arms. Length-wise, this is great. If you’re tall and worried about it being too short, I don’t think that will be an issue at all. It hits comfortably and covers what it should.
I normally wear a medium, but in this case, sizing down would likely give a more flattering, streamlined look, especially if you want it to skim your body instead of hang loosely.
The Neckline Detail:
This is a small thing, but if you’re detail-oriented like me, you might notice it.
The neckline on mine looks slightly different than some of the product photos. The small crochet circle detail at the top center of the chest appears thinner and a bit more delicate than what’s shown online. It doesn’t feel like it’s going to unravel, but it does look more fragile than expected.
Not a deal-breaker, just something I noticed and wanted to mention for accuracy.

Overall Thoughts:
This is a really nice, easy cover-up. It’s lightweight, breathable, and perfect for beach days, pool lounging, or resort wear. It’s not meant to be structured or tailored, it’s meant to be thrown on and lived in.
At under $25, I think it’s a solid buy. Would I pay luxury prices for it? No. Would I grab it in the right size at this price point? Yes, especially if I needed a simple, versatile cover-up for summer.
If you’re tall:
*Length is not an issue
*Consider sizing down for a better fit
*Expect a relaxed, drapey look rather than a fitted one
